Features

AI Translation
  • V max: maximum operating voltage the device can withstand without damage at rated current (Imax).
  • I max: maximum fault current the device can withstand without damage at rated voltage (V max).
  • I hold: hold current — maximum current at which the device will not trip in still air at 25℃.
  • I trip: trip current — minimum current at which the device will always trip in still air at 25℃.
  • Pd: power dissipation of the device in the tripped state at rated voltage in still air at 25℃.
  • Ri min/max: minimum/maximum resistance of the device before tripping at 25℃.
  • R1max: maximum device resistance measured one hour after reflow soldering.
  • Operating beyond specified ratings may cause damage and may result in arcing and flame.
  • Recommended reflow methods: infrared, vapor phase, forced hot air, and nitrogen atmosphere for lead-free.
  • Recommended maximum solder paste thickness: 0.25mm.
  • The device can be cleaned using standard industry methods and solvents.
  • Terminal pad material: tin-plated nickel-copper; terminal pad solderability complies with EIA RS186-9E and ANSI/J-STD-002 Category 3.
  • Tape and reel packaging per EIA481-1.
